    ### SIG-autoscaling
    
    SIG Autoscaling focused on improving the Horizontal Pod Autoscaling API and algorithm:
    - We released autoscaling/v2beta2, which cleans up and unifies the API
    - We improved readiness detection and smoothing to work well in a larger variety or use cases
